So, let&#8217;s get started and uncover the truth about Waterpiks and their plaque-removing abilities.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h3 id=\"h-what-is-a-waterpik-and-how-does-it-work\" class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>What is a Waterpik and how does it work?<\/strong><\/h3>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A Waterpik, also known as an oral irrigator or dental water jet, is a handheld device that uses a stream of water to clean teeth and gums. It works by directing a pressurised stream of water into the spaces between teeth and along the gumline, flushing out food particles, bacteria, and plaque.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Waterpiks typically consist of a motor that powers a pump, a reservoir for holding water, and a nozzle that directs the water flow. Some models also come with interchangeable tips or attachments for various cleaning needs, such as orthodontic braces or periodontal pockets.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<div class=\"wp-block-buttons is-horizontal is-content-justification-center is-layout-flex wp-container-core-buttons-is-layout-7d812b4c wp-block-buttons-is-layout-flex\">\r\n<div class=\"wp-block-button\"><a class=\"wp-block-button__link has-text-color has-background wp-element-button\" style=\"border-radius: 2px; color: #fffffa; background-color: #ba0c49;\" href=\"tel:+919820446633\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Call Now<\/a><\/div>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<div class=\"wp-block-button is-style-outline is-style-outline--1\"><a class=\"wp-block-button__link has-text-color wp-element-button\" style=\"border-radius: 2px; color: #ba0c49;\" href=\"https:\/\/royalimplant.com\/enquiry5\/?utm_source=blogs&amp;utm_medium=organic&amp;utm_campaign=5%20foods%20that%20make%20your%20kids%20teeth%20stronger\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Get In Touch<\/a><\/div>\r\n<\/div>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">One of the key benefits of using a Waterpik is that it can reach areas of the mouth that may be difficult to clean with traditional brushing and flossing. For example, it can effectively clean around dental implants or under orthodontic wires and brackets.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">However, it&#8217;s important to note that a Waterpik should not be used as a substitute for regular brushing and flossing. Rather, it should be used as a supplementary tool to enhance oral hygiene.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h3 id=\"h-scientific-studies-on-effective-waterpik-in-plaque-removal\" class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Scientific Studies on effective Waterpik in Plaque removal<\/strong><\/h3>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A 2011 study published in the Journal of Clinical Dentistry found that using a Waterpik for one minute per day was significantly more effective at reducing gingivitis and bleeding than using dental floss.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A 2013 study published in the International Journal of Dental Hygiene compared the effectiveness of a Waterpik with dental floss for removing plaque in people with braces. The study found that the Waterpik was significantly more effective at removing plaque from around the brackets and wires.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<figure class=\"wp-block-gallery has-nested-images columns-default is-cropped wp-block-gallery-2 is-layout-flex wp-block-gallery-is-layout-flex\">\r\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large is-style-rounded\"><img fetchpriority=\"high\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"506\" height=\"900\" data-id=\"36779\" class=\"wp-image-36779\" src=\"https:\/\/royalimplant.com\/blogs\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/10\/Smile-Beautification-506x900.png\" alt=\"Smile Makeover\" title=\"\">\r\n<fig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Missing Teeth Replacement<\/figcaption>\r\n<\/figure>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full is-style-rounded\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"800\" height=\"534\" data-id=\"45266\" class=\"wp-image-45266\" src=\"https:\/\/royalimplant.com\/blogs\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/01\/Proxy-brush.jpg\" alt=\"Proxy brush Anti-Plaque\" title=\"\">\r\n<fig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Proxy brush as dental floss<\/figcaption>\r\n<\/figure>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full is-style-rounded\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"673\" height=\"377\" data-id=\"8786\" class=\"wp-image-8786\" src=\"https:\/\/royalimplant.com\/blogs\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/01\/erosion.jpg\" alt=\"Teeth brushing old women\" title=\"\">\r\n<fig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Aging<\/figcaption>\r\n<\/figure>\r\n<\/figure>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">2017 systematic review published in the Journal of Clinical Periodontology looked at 10 studies comparing the effectiveness of a Waterpik with other methods of oral hygiene, including dental floss, interdental brushes, and manual toothbrushing alone. The review found that the Waterpik was effective at reducing plaque and gingivitis compared to all other methods.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h3 id=\"h-user-experiences-and-reviews-of-waterpik\" class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>User experiences and reviews of Waterpik<\/strong><\/h3>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">User experiences and reviews of Waterpiks vary, but many people find them to be a helpful addition to their oral hygiene routine.
